WebJul 7, 2024 · Because they are nonpolar and wateris polar, lipids are not soluble in water. That means the lipid molecules andwater molecules do not bond or share electrons in any way. The lipids just float in the water without blending into it. You’ve probably heard the old adage, “oil and water don’t mix.” Are lipids polar covalent compounds? WebHow do lipids react to water?
